
Cell C confirms talks with Starlink and Amazon Leo, and how satellite fits its asset-light network and rural coverage plans.
Cell C has confirmed that it is in discussions with low-Earth orbit satellite operators including Starlink and Amazon Leo as it weighs two very different satellite opportunities: extending mobile coverage directly from space and reselling satellite broadband to customers beyond the reach of terrestrial networks.
The talks do not amount to a signed South African launch deal, and Cell C has not disclosed which providers it expects to work with, on what terms, or when any service could go live. But the direction matters because it fits neatly into the operator's broader strategy: use other companies' infrastructure where it makes sense, keep capital requirements lower, and focus on the customer relationship rather than owning every layer of the network.
Cell C told MyBroadband that it continues to engage with a range of industry participants, including LEO satellite providers, as part of its assessment of future connectivity opportunities. The company is considering both direct-to-cell arrangements and the resale of satellite broadband packages.
Direct-to-cell and fixed satellite broadband are often discussed as though they are the same thing. They are not.
A direct-to-cell service uses satellites to communicate with compatible ordinary mobile phones, potentially filling gaps where there is no terrestrial cell tower. That could be useful on farms, along roads and in sparsely populated areas where building conventional radio sites is difficult to justify commercially.
Fixed LEO broadband is closer to a satellite version of fibre or fixed wireless. Customers use a dedicated terminal or antenna at a home or business, with the satellite constellation providing the backhaul connection.
For Cell C, the first option could add coverage without requiring it to build thousands of rural sites. The second could give it a product to sell in places where fibre, fixed wireless and conventional mobile broadband are weak or unavailable.
That is why the satellite question is especially relevant to Cell C. The operator has spent years moving away from a traditional infrastructure-heavy mobile model. It relies extensively on roaming and network-sharing arrangements with larger operators while retaining its own spectrum, core network, brand and customer base. Satellite could become another wholesale network layer in that mix.
Amazon Leo already has a publicly announced South African partner. In July, Amazon said Herotel would use its satellite network for a new residential service called evry, with commercial launch expected in 2027. Amazon says the agreement is intended to reach homes and small businesses beyond fibre and fixed-wireless coverage.
Herotel will bring an existing local footprint to the deal. Amazon says the ISP serves more than 350,000 active customers across more than 550 towns and has 120 local offices.
The regulatory groundwork is also moving. ICASA is in the middle of updating South Africa's satellite licensing framework. Its 2026 draft changes cover a registration regime for satellite space-segment operators, blanket licensing for satellite terminal networks and revised spectrum fees. Amazon Leo, SpaceX, MTN, Vodacom and other industry players have all participated in the regulator's consultation process.
That means there is a plausible path for more satellite wholesale partnerships, but it does not mean every provider can simply switch on service. Local electronic communications licences, spectrum authorisations and the final shape of ICASA's satellite rules still matter.
Starlink is the obvious name in LEO broadband because SpaceX already has the world's most mature consumer satellite network. It also has coverage over South Africa. What it does not have is a commercial South African service.
That distinction matters when reading too much into Cell C's discussions. A conversation with Starlink is not the same as regulatory approval, a reseller agreement or a launch date.
SpaceX has participated in ICASA's satellite and communications-licensing consultations, so the company is clearly engaged with the South African regulatory process. But there is still no announced Starlink consumer launch in the country.
Cell C therefore has more certainty, at least publicly, around Amazon Leo's planned South African market entry than it does around Starlink. Amazon has named a local partner and a 2027 target.
The operator does not need to win a satellite race on engineering. Its value could be in distribution, billing, customer support and bundling.
A Cell C customer could theoretically buy terrestrial mobile service for everyday use and a satellite product for a farm, lodge, remote business or backup connection under the same commercial relationship. Direct-to-cell could eventually make that proposition more interesting by reducing dead zones without requiring a separate broadband terminal for basic mobile connectivity.
None of that is confirmed yet. Cell C has not announced a product, pricing, launch window or provider. There is also no evidence yet that a satellite partnership would materially change the operator's economics.
What is confirmed is that South Africa's satellite market is becoming less theoretical. Amazon Leo has a local commercial route, ICASA is rewriting the satellite rulebook, and multiple mobile operators are exploring partnerships with LEO providers.
For Cell C, that creates an opportunity that looks unusually well matched to the company it has become: a mobile operator trying to compete without owning every piece of the network underneath the service.
